The Cheaters (Al-Mutaffifeen)
In the name of Allah, the Compassionate, the Merciful
Woe to the diminishers, 1 who demand of other people full measure for themselves, 2 but when they measure or weigh, give less. 3 Do they not think they will be raised (to life) again 4 For a mighty day, 5 the Day when people will stand before the Lord of the Worlds? 6 By no means! Verily the record of the ungodly is in Sijjin. 7 What could let you know what the Sijjeen is! 8 A written record. 9 Woe on that Day unto those who give the lie to the truth 10 Those who deny the Day of Judgment 11 No one denies it except for the evil aggressor. 12 When Our Signs are rehearsed to him, he says, "Tales of the ancients!" 13 Nay, but their hearts are corroded by all [the evil] that they were wont to do! 14 Verily, from (the Light of) their Lord, that Day, will they be veiled. 15 and then they shall enter Hell, 16 Then shall it be said: This is what you gave the lie to. 17 Nay, but the record of the righteous is in 'Illiyin - 18 And what will make you know what 'Illiyyun is? 19 It is a Book inscribed, 20 which the angels placed near Allah to safeguard. 21 Verily the virtuous shall be in Bliss; 22 upon couches gazing; 23 thou knowest in their faces the radiancy of bliss 24 They will be given pure wine to drink, which is kept preserved, sealed. 25 With a sealing of musk, which those who aspire for the best should desire, -- 26 And the admixture of it is a water of Tasnim, 27 A spring whence those brought near (to Allah) drink. 28 Indeed the guilty used to laugh at the believers. 29 And when the believers used to pass by, they used to gesture at each other with their eyes. 30 and, on returning to their people, boast about what they had done. 31 And when they saw them, they said: Most surely these are in error; 32 And withal, they have no call to watch over [the beliefs of] others... 33 So this day it is the believers who laugh at the disbelievers. 34 Regarding them from their cushioned seats. 35 The infidels have indeed been rewarded for that which they had been doing. 36
